Output 33acbf1e98c5dfd59800e3a5a13f99cf49da3eeaa90d9a1ac5bc8bb74191a24d:1

value
594000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43af9b36079d3d938cc484abf9fd324b27dc8a0b OP_EQUAL
address
37ruZjcdUHdNC5FkBDLaVdBoabPW6gzqhv
transaction
33acbf1e98c5dfd59800e3a5a13f99cf49da3eeaa90d9a1ac5bc8bb74191a24d
spent
true